On Thu, 18 Sep 2003, Jared Mauch wrote:
: ultradns uses the power of anycast to have these ips that appear
: to be on close subnets in geographyically diverse locations.
Oh, that's brilliant. How nice of them to defeat the concept of redundancy
by limiting me to only two of their servers for a gTLD.
VeriSign might be doing some loathsome things lately, but at least my named
has several more servers than just two to choose from.
: could you provide some more technical details, other than
: your postulations that they have two machines on
: network-wise close subnets and that is the problem?
I tracerouted to both IPs from two different locations in the USA; both took
the same route before hitting !H from an ultradns.com rDNS machine. And
both servers for that route were completely unresponsive from both tried
locations during the outage period.
